3 Lesson 1 Introduction to Geometry Do you like to draw pictures or play with legos? If so, then you will like geometry. Geometry is the study of shapes. There are two kinds of shapes; plane shapes and solid shapes. Plane shapes are flat shapes, as if you were drawing on paper. These are examples of plane shapes, which we will learn more about in later sections: a point, a line, a circle, a triangle, a rectangle and a square. Page 7 of 110

4 Those are the plane shapes. Now let s look at some solid shapes. Legos are solid shapes. If a shape looks like it can be filled, then it s a solid shape. Do you see how it looks like we can fill up this cylinder? We often use cylinders to measure liquids, like water. These are examples of the solid shapes we are going to learn more about: a sphere, a cone, a pyramid, a cylinder, a rectangular prism and a cube. Page 8 of 110

5 In geometry, we study the properties of shapes. For example, we can describe shapes by how many dimensions they have. Shapes can have 0, 1, 2 or 3 dimensions. We can also describe shapes by how many vertices, edges and faces they have. We will learn more about these properties in the next sections. 14 Lesson 3 Dimensions of Shapes Plane shapes and solid shapes can be described by how many dimensions they have. A dimension is basically a line that goes in one direction. For example, this juice box has 3 lines going in different directions, which are labeled length, width and height. So, this juice box has 3 dimensions and is called a 3-dimensional shape. A shape can have 0, 1, 2 or 3 dimensions. To determine how many dimensions a shape has, we must determine how many lines the shape has. Page 18 of 110

15 Let s start with a 0-dimensional shape. If a shape has 0 dimensions, then it cannot have length, width or height. Therefore, the only 0-dimensional shape is a point because a point does not have any lines. In Geometry, a point is not a thing, but a place or a specific location in space. A line is a collection of points along a straight path that goes on forever in both directions. A line only has length, not width or height. 19 Lesson 4 Vertices, Edges and Faces We have learned we can identify shapes by how many dimensions they have. We can also identify them by other properties, such as how many vertices, edges and faces they have. Let s start with how many vertices shapes have. Vertices is plural for vertex. A vertex is the corner where 2 or more lines meet. If we draw another line here, what shape did we make? Page 23 of 110

28 Lesson 5 Polygons Polygons are 2-dimensional plane shapes. All of these shapes are polygons. A polygon has many straight sides that connect to one another making a closed shape. These shapes are not polygons. Can you tell me why? Polygons cannot have curves, just straight sides. So, all of the shapes with curves are not polygons. This includes the circle and oval.
